Where each one falls short
Documented limitations, not opinions. Every one is a constraint you would hit in normal use.
LiveAgent
- Social and messaging channels are separately priced add ons rather than plan features, at $19 to $39 a month each on top of the seat price
- The entry plan is limited to 3 email accounts, 2 live chat buttons and 3 contact forms
- WhatsApp numbers are rationed by plan, at 5 on Large Business and 20 on Enterprise
- The advertised prices require annual billing, and monthly billing raises the entry plan from $10 to $13 per agent
- Every published price is a discounted rate against a higher regular price
tawk.to
- Removing the Powered by tawk.to branding costs an extra $29/month even on the free plan
- Enhanced AI Assist chatbot is a paid add-on starting at $29/month rather than included free
- Human staffed chat agents are billed at $1/hour as a separate add-on

Answered from the vendors’ own pages
LiveAgent: How much does LiveAgent cost?
LiveAgent charges per agent on annual billing: Small Business at $10/agent/month, Medium at $19/agent/month, Large at $33/agent/month, and Enterprise at $46/agent/month (regular rates are $15, $29, $49, and $69 respectively). Monthly billing costs 30% more.
Sourcetawk.to: How much does tawk.to cost?
tawk.to is free for core live chat, knowledge base, ticketing, and CRM. Premium add-ons start at $29/month for branding removal or AI Assist, and $1/hour for hired chat agents.
SourceLiveAgent: Does LiveAgent offer a free trial?
Yes, LiveAgent provides a 30-day free trial with no credit card required, offering full access to all features including AI agents.
Sourcetawk.to: Is tawk.to free forever?
Yes, tawk.to's core software including live chat, knowledge base, ticketing, and contacts is free forever with no feature limitations.
SourceLiveAgent: Are AI agents included in all LiveAgent plans?
Yes, all LiveAgent plans include free AI agents with features like chatbots, answer assistants, human handover, and autoresponders.
Sourcetawk.to: How are tawk.to's hired chat agents priced?
Hired chat agents are billed at $1 per hour with professional trained staff providing 24/7/365 support.
